What is ServiceControl?
ServiceControl is an identity management solution that is designed to provide a simpler way to create, manage, and audit accounts across multiple systems. This software is targeted at solution architects, IDM and IAM project managers, line-of-business application owners, and busy IT administrators who need to find a simpler way to delegate identity management and account creation tasks to front-line staff - without having to train them on multiple account management tools that are complex and often require full admin rights and security permissions.
The vendor’s value proposition is that their solution not only delivers an immediate ROI, the solution is efficient, cuts down on training costs and the advanced audit and reporting will help companies pass their next IT, IDM and IAM audits with flying colors.
Companies can use the ServiceControl wizard to connect to systems they wish to manage. Users have full control over the tasks they delegate and the users and groups that can be managed by their front-line staff.
According to the vendor, the flexible account creation form tool allows users to map to fields across multiple systems. This solution is also designed to enable user self-service functions. All self-service functions are also captured by ServiceControl's fuII audit log for reporting.
ServiceControl Features
- Supported: Create. Quickly and easily enable front-line staff to provision new user accounts across multiple systems. From a simple web form, staff can set up directory and email accounts, create new CRM and ERP accounts, assign group memberships, account restrictions and more.
- Supported: Self-service. Empower end-users to reset their own passwords, manage subscriptions to public distribution lists, and update their contact information across multiple systems. Implement ''forgot-my-password" challenge phrases and more.
- Supported: Manage. Deliver simplified, role-based management of user accounts, security groups, email groups and other directory objects in AD, Office 365, Exchange, eDirectory, GroupWise, Open LDAP, SAP, Oracle, and other systems from a secure unified management application you can access from anywhere.
- Supported: Audit and reporting. ServiceControl improves security and compliance by Iimiting accounts with elevated privileges in your systems. Complete audit logs provide advanced reporting capabilities against all actions, even if someone just views an account. This will help you pass your next security audit with flying colors.
